Dubai’s most affordable residential areas

Buying a home at a price that does not leave one cash-strapped for months is a dream millions around the world dream each day.
This becomes all the more pertinent in rapidly developing cities like Dubai that welcome thousands of new expats each month and who are in constant need of accommodation.
As many settling down in a new city are looking for affordable housing solutions, Bayut.com has provided a list of areas across Dubai where prices can be termed the most affordable.
While its great news for families and professionals planning a long stay in Dubai, the list also brings good news for investors, who will certainly find themselves attracted to Dubai after considering the high rental yields these affordable areas offer.

International City
International City is a large community lying in the city’s suburbs and is generally considered the most affordable area to rent or buy properties in Dubai.
It is home to thousands of expats, though a majority belongs to the South Asian origin.
Apartments in the community are cheap, and average prices in the first half of year 2016 were recorded at AED514,000.
Rents in H1 averaged AED 43,000, providing owners a yield of 8 percent.

Al-Mamzar
The next most affordable residential community in Dubai was Al Mamzar, where apartment prices averaged AED712,000 in H1 2016.
With overall apartment rents averaging about AED67,000, producing a mean rental yield of 9%.

IMPZ
IMPZ is another suburban locality gaining popularity with residents.
The area is easily accessible from various main roads and apartments in the locality a prices of AED720,000 on average. Average rents in IMPZ were recorded at AED58,500 in the first half, amounting to a rental yield of 8 percent.

Reem Community
The Emaar backed project is still in the development phase but properties are expected to start being handed over by the next year. Currently, apartment prices in the area average close to AED798,000.

Dubai Silicon Oasis
Dubai Silicon Oasis has climbed several popularity ranks over the past months and become one of the most preferred living communities in Dubai’s suburbs. The locality has swathes of green spaces and provides an ideal living environment. Apartment prices in the area averaged AED 849,000 in H1’16, while rents averaged AED 69,000. The area provided homeowners an average rental yield of 8%.

Dubai Sports City
Stadiums, sports arenas and gymnasiums, Dubai Sports City is an ideal living community for those seeking an active lifestyle. There is plenty of greenery in the area, making its broad avenues a sight for sore eyes.
On average, apartment in the area commanded prices of AED 896,000 in the first half, while overall apartment rents averaged AED73,000, making rental yields stand tall at 8.2%.

Dubai Investment Park (DIP)
Though DIP is fairly far away from the city center, the distance does not make it any less popular with residents.
The area will gain immense importance in the coming years as it lies close to the site of Expo 2020 as well as the Al-Maktoum International Airport.
In H1’16, apartments in DIP commanded an average price of AED943,000, while rents hovered around the AED83,000 mark.
The locality’s distance from the city center might well be playing to its advantage, as unit owners enjoyed a rental yield of 8.8 percent in the first half of the year on average.

Dubai Studio City
Dubai Studio City wraps our list of Dubai areas where average apartment prices remained lower than AED1 million in the first half of 2016.
The area is popular with artists and media agencies and has plenty of activity going on.
Unit prices in area averaged AED957,000 in the first half of the year, while rents averaged AED69,000, returning a yield of 7.2 percent
